温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Ubuntu服务器系统日志审计方法

发布时间:2024-12-28 17:16:55 来源:亿速云 阅读:86 作者:小樊 栏目:建站服务器

Ubuntu服务器系统日志审计是确保系统安全性的重要环节,通过配置和使用特定的工具,可以有效地监控系统活动,及时发现并响应潜在的安全威胁。以下是Ubuntu服务器系统日志审计的详细方法:

Ubuntu系统日志审计方法

  • 开启SELinux:确保SELinux已经开启,可以通过编辑 /etc/selinux/config 文件来设置SELinux的模式。
  • 安装和配置auditd服务:使用 sudo apt-get install auditd audispd-plugins 安装auditd服务,并编辑 /etc/audit/auditd.conf 文件来配置日志文件的存储位置和大小限制。启动并启用auditd服务,使用 sudo systemctl start auditdsudo systemctl enable auditd
  • 配置审计规则:使用 auditctl 命令配置要监控的文件和目录,例如监控 /var/log 目录的所有读写操作。
  • 查看和搜索审计日志:使用 ausearch 命令查看和搜索审计日志,例如查找与特定键相关的所有事件。
  • 日志分析:根据需要分析审计日志,以识别潜在的安全问题或异常行为。

使用的工具和技术

  • SELinux:提供强制访问控制安全模块,增强系统安全性。
  • auditd:核心审计守护进程,负责监控系统中发生的所有与安全相关的活动。
  • rsyslog/syslog-ng:系统日志服务,负责收集、处理和转发日志消息。
  • journalctl:命令行工具,用于查看和管理日志。
  • logwatch/logcheck:日志分析工具,自动化日志文件的分析过程。
  • ELK Stack:Elasticsearch, Logstash, Kibana组合,用于更复杂的日志分析和可视化。

实施步骤和注意事项

  • 实施步骤
    1. 开启并配置SELinux。
    2. 安装并配置auditd服务。
    3. 设置审计规则并监控关键文件和目录。
    4. 定期查看和分析审计日志。
  • 注意事项
    • 定期审查日志,以及时发现并响应任何潜在问题。
    • 结合其他安全措施,如定期更新系统和软件,使用强密码策略等,以进一步提高系统安全性。

通过上述方法,您可以有效地对Ubuntu服务器进行系统日志审计,从而提高系统的安全性和可追溯性。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I